预订演示

请注意 : 本帮助页面不适用于最新版本的Enterprise Architect. 最新的帮助文档在这里.

前页 后页

从 XMI导入

您可以在模型之间复制Enterprise Architect模型元素,以获得分布式开发、手动版本控制等好处。您可以通过以下任何格式从 XMI(基于 XML)/Native 文件导入父包:

  • UML 1 .3 (XMI 1 .0)
  • UML 1 .3 (XMI 1 . 1 )
  • UML 1 .4 (XMI 1 .2)
  • UML 2.x (XMI 2.1 1
  • MOF 1 .3 (XMI 1 . 1 )
  • MOF 1 .4 (XMI 1 .2)
  • Enterprise Architect的原生 XEA/XML
您还可以导入 Rational软件架构师(RSA) 和 Rational Software Modeler (RSM) 等工具生成的 *.emx 和 * 1文件,以及 Canonical XMI 2.1 文件、BPMN 2.0 XML 文件、 Rhapsody和MagicDraw 模型和 ArcGIS 导出的 XML 文件。

访问

在浏览器窗口中选择你的目标包,然后:

功能区

发布>模型交换>导入包>从Native/XMI文件导入包

键盘快捷键

Ctrl+Alt+I

从一个 XML文件导入一个包

选项

行动

也见

文件名

类型从中导入 XML/XEA 文件的目录路径和文件名。

导入图

选中复选框以导入图表。

移 除 GUIDs

选中复选框以在导入时从文件中删除通用标识符信息。

通过删除GUID ,您可以将一个包两次导入到同一个模型中;第二次导入需要选中复选框,以应用新的 GUID 以避免元素冲突。

写入log文件

选中复选框以写入导入活动log (推荐)。

log文件保存在导入文件的目录下,与导入文件同名加后缀_import。 log 。

使用单一事务导入

此选项默认设置为“首选项”对话框的“XML 规范”页面中的“导入单个事务”复选框。如果您愿意,可以更改默认设置的选项。

如果选中该复选框,文件将在一个事务中导入。不建议大量导入。

如果未选中该复选框,则单独导入数据项;您可以在不阻止整个导入的情况下识别问题项目。如果导入可能会遇到锁定问题,或者如果您要导入大文件,请取消选中该复选框。

XML 规范

导入讨论

此选项默认设置为“模型”对话框的“General”页面上的“XMI/导入for Discussions”选项的设置。

如果在“管理模型选项”对话框的“常规”页面上选择了“提示时允许用户覆盖”选项,则该选项将被启用。

如果启用,单击下拉箭头并选择确定如何从 XML 导入讨论的选项:

  • 从 XML 合并 - 选择此选项以保留模型中的现有讨论并合并 Native/XMI 文件中的讨论
  • 从 XML 恢复 - 选择此选项可删除模型中的现有讨论并导入 Native/XMI 文件中的讨论
模型选项

合并 XMI

单击此按钮显示两个选项,用于将 XMI 文件的内容与所选包的内容合并。

  • '使用合并文件' - 使用合并文件将 XMI 文件的内容与包的内容合并
  • 'Direct Merge' - 将 XMI 文件的内容直接与包的内容合并,无需 Merge文件
与 XMI 合并 使用 Merge文件与 XMI 合并

处理导入的数据类型

如果您从 Rose XMI 1导入。 1 ,单击下拉箭头并选择要添加到模型的数据类型。

基线导入包

选中复选框打开“创建此基线导入”对话框以完成导入包。

选择此选项还会在将包导出到 XMI 1时生成 Merge文件。 1使用'导出包到Native/XMI文件'对话框。

创造基线 导出到 XMI

导入

单击此按钮开始导入。

单击此按钮可关闭对话框。

帮助

单击此按钮可显示此帮助页面。

导入进度

指示导入的进度。

占位符

导入Enterprise Architect模型作为 XMI 1时。 1 /2。 1或具有跨包引用的本机 XML/XEA 文件,您可以使用占位符选项在导入的图表上直观地显示在源模型中引用的任何项目,但由于这些原因,这些项目并未直接成为导出的一部分元素位于导出的包树之外。有关更多详细信息,请参阅在 XMI 1期间为缺少的外部引用创建占位符选项。 1 /2。 1、在XML Specifications帮助主题中1导入文件

注记

  • 在Enterprise Architect的企业、统一和终极包版本中,如果启用了安全性,则必须具有“导入XML”权限才能从 XML 导入
  • 如果您在云连接上的模型中工作,您从 XMI 导入的能力可能会被“管理模型选项”对话框的“云”页面上设置的模型特定选项阻止;您仍然可以使用直接连接到模型从 XMI 导入
  • 如果您连接到#
    服务器存储库,您需要对Enterprise Architect中的 t_image表具有 ALTER 权限,才能导入模型图像
  • 当您在现有包上导入 XML 文件时,首先删除当前包中的所有信息,除非您使用使用使用并文件按钮;在导入 XML 文件之前,请确保您没有不想丢失的重要更改
  • 如果您要导入 XMI 1 。 1之前使用 UML_EA.DTD 文件导出的文件,UML_EA.DTD 文件必须存在于 XMI 文件正在写入的目录中;如果 UML_EA.DTD 文件不存在,则会发生错误
  • Enterprise Architect 7.0 或更高版本导出的 XMI 1文件可能无法被早于 7.0版本的Enterprise Architect正确导入
  • Enterprise Architect 15.0 或更高版本导出A Native XML 文件不能被早于 15.0版本的Enterprise Architect导入
  • 由Enterprise Architect 16.0 或更高版本导出的A机 XEA 文件不能由早于 16.0版本的Enterprise Architect版本导入

了解更多